This trail was commissioned by the Malvern Hills District Council and was assisted by a local historian. 

This walk spans a route of about 2.6 miles (4.2 km) and should take about 2 to 3 hours to complete at a comfortable walking pace. Please note that, as the town is situated on a hillside, some sections are steep, and the route is predominantly uphill. 

The route starts at the train station, encouraging you to travel by public transport.
